## Session Handling for Health Checks

The Corvel gateway sits behind the Lanternside load balancer, which probes /healthz every ten seconds. Health-check requests are stateless by design: they bypass the session store entirely so that probe traffic never inflates session counts or evicts real user sessions. New team members should note that the deep-check endpoint, /healthz/deep, does verify session-store connectivity and therefore requires authentication. When probing it manually, supply the token below.

bearer token for tajep-kajef: eyJhbGciOiJIUzI1NiIsInR5cCI6IkpXVCJ9.eyJzdWIiOiIoOsZ23In0.CsygO0hs

// Heads up for the sync: this is the bucket count for the waveform
// preview strip in Pondhopper. We downsample audio into this many
// amplitude bins so the preview renders in one paint pass. Bumping it
// past 512 makes scrubbing janky on older tablets — we tested, it's
// real. If you change it, re-run the render bench and note the build
// you measured on; that token goes right here.

pipeline stamp: htk9_ce63042d9

Leadership Review Briefing — Divestiture

For the incoming director: the sale of the Kestrelmoor tooling unit is in late-stage negotiation with Obrany Holdings. Valuation range agreed; warranties under discussion. Two staff consultations remain. Expect completion within the quarter, pending regulatory clearance. Keep circulation tight. The confidential note on onward plans sits directly below.

management briefing: Project Ulavan slips by two quarters because of the staffing delay.

Handover note — Driftbin retention sweeper

To whoever maintains Driftbin next: the sweeper runs hourly and deletes expired records in small batches to avoid lock contention on the archive tables. Never raise the batch size without checking replica lag first — Ottoline learned that the hard way. The settings currently deployed to production are listed below.

service settings:
PRAWYN_PIN=9848
PRAWYN_METRICS_HOST=metrics.prawyn.lumicworks.corp
PRAWYN_LOG_LEVEL=warn
PRAWYN_TENANT=pelius